Notes:
Everything is set to load at start that needs to be running (with the exception of *voice command, see below). So Wisbar will load at start and use the settings I found to work well.

I removed everything that I felt was junk which includes the MSN apps, help files, doc templates, sample images, and other non-useful junk (at least junk to me). There was a lot removed.

*NOTE1: Voice command had the EXE removed as this is commercial software. All you need to do is copy your EXE in to the windows dir, create a shortcut to the startup folder and map your button to the exe (recomend using button #5.

*NOTE2: The A2DP has changed for PR6 (PR4-PR5sp1 have the alternate values listed below) the new values here have been reset for use with MortPlayer and will casue WMP to skip at the begining of each song as it loads device.exe at 99% cpu usage for the first 20 seconds of playback. Other media players do not do this and is why I have Mort now set as default. If you want to use media player I recomend the following changes:
Remove reg keys:
[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Software\Microsoft\Bluetooth\A2 DP\Settings]
"MaxSupportedBitPool"=dword:00000050
"MinSupportedBitPool"=dword:00000032

(These allow the system to scale the quality based on the source)
Then add:
[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Software\Microsoft\Bluetooth\A2 DP\Settings]
"Bitpool"=dword:0000001e

Decimal values range from 58-30 (Highest to lowest)
Basicly this will hard set the quality of the audio at 34. I picked the value that worked without skipping nearly 100% of the time in WMP. This value can be raised if you do not notice skipping or if you use another app.

Vang:

I couldn't find where I found these before but I have these set in custom CAB file I run that loads all my licenses and settings upon a hard reset and these are my notes:

DSOD RELATED IMPROVMENTS

HKLM\Drivers\SDCARD\SDBusDriver
PowerUpPollingInterval - 2 (Dword)
PowerUpPollingTime - 2000 (Dword)

HKLM\System\CurrentControlSet\Control\Power\States \Suspend
dsk1 - 2 (DWORD)
Prevents the SD Card from going into suspend; the main cause of DSOD
cam1 - 4 (DWORD)
Forces the camera to turn off during suspend, saving power.

PERFORMANCE RELATED IMPROVMENTS

HKLM\System\CurrentControlSet\Control\Power\States \Unattended
wav1 - 2 (DWORD)
Prevents the sound card from turning off while the unit is unattended mode.

HKLM\Drivers\SDCARD\ClientDrivers\Class\SDMemory_C lass
*BlockTransferSize - 64 (Dword)
*If you experience skipping audio try 32 or 16.
Specifies the maximum amount of blocks to send per bus transfer.
*SingleBlockWrites - 1 (Dword)
*Optional, may help with skipping video when recording to SD.
This over rides BlockTransferSize and forces the driver to use single block transfers.

Time sync problem
 
saridnour and all...

I found this on the unified rom project discussion...and have verified it myself...

"The initial setup wizard does not implement timezones with the 2007 Daylight Savings Time. As a result, after a hard reset, go into Settings\System\Clock & Alarms once in order to set the timezone properly. (Reference: bug 12) "

It explains the inconsistencies we have seen with people syncing to the phone network...I have verified that this fixes my time syncing issues with Sprint...
